Breaking Down the Features of Alkaline Battery Carrier Assembly

Specifications

The Alkaline Battery Carrier Assembly is designed specifically as a replacement for Streamlight Knucklehead, Knucklehead HAZ-LO, and Survivor LED flashlights. It houses four AA alkaline batteries. It provides the necessary voltage for these devices. The carrier itself is constructed of durable plastic. It weighs only a few ounces without batteries installed. The specified recharge time for compatible lights is 3.5 hours.

These specifications are important because they ensure proper fit and function within the designated Streamlight flashlights. Incorrect voltage or poor contact can lead to dim light, short runtimes, or even damage to the flashlight. Using a genuine Streamlight replacement part minimizes these risks and ensures optimal performance.
